Where to stay in Liverpool City Centre

The Docks
Visitors to The Docks rave about its fantastic nightlife, beautiful waterfront views and popular shops. You might also want to make some time to see Royal Albert Dock or Merseyside Maritime Museum while you're exploring the neighbourhood.

Anfield
You'll enjoy the museums and gardens in Anfield. You might want to make time for a stop at Anfield Stadium or LFC Museum and Tour Centre.

Ropewalks
Ropewalks is known for its popular shops, and you can see some sights area like Chinatown and Concert Square.

Everton
Travellers enjoy Everton for its restaurants and museums. Consider checking out World of Glass while you're in the area.

Knowledge Quarter
While visiting Knowledge Quarter, you might make a stop by sights like Philharmonic Hall and Hope Street.
